"Azerbaijan makes continuous efforts in establishment of interreligious peace and tolerance,” said Ambassador Khaled Fathalrahman, Director of the Center for Civilizational Dialogue of the Islamic World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(ICESCO), at a panel discussion titled “A call for global dialogue to encourage tolerance, peace and respect for human rights and religious diversity” within the framework of the international scientific conference on the “Embracing Diversity: Tackling Islamophobia in 2024” held in Baku, APA reports.

“I express gratitude to the Azerbaijani government for its continuous efforts. Azerbaijan makes continuous efforts in establishment of interreligious peace and tolerance. I thank the participants of this conference. I thank you all on behalf of 54 countries to thank you. Our organization encourages dialogue between civilizations. We accept non-Islamic countries as members too,” he said.
